Israel Blasted for Writing Numbers on Arabs

Wednesday, March 13, 2002

JERUSALEM — An Israeli lawmaker who survived the Nazi Holocaust expressed outrage Tuesday over Israeli troops writing identification numbers on the foreheads and forearms of Palestinian detainees awaiting interrogation during an army sweep of a West Bank refugee camp.

Yugoslav-born Tommy Lapid said he told army chief of staff Lt. Gen. Shaul Mofaz and Defense Minister Binyamin Ben-Eliezer that the practice must cease immediately.

"As a refugee from the Holocaust I find such an act insufferable," Lapid said, adding that Mofaz and Ben-Eliezer also were displeased with the practice and that both had pledged action.

During World War II, concentration camp inmates, most of them Jews, had numbers tattooed on their forearms.

Mofaz later said in a radio interview that he had ordered an immediate halt to the numbering, which the army said was done to identify and keep track of prisoners last week in the Tulkarem refugee camp.
